Inpatient Treatment - Drug and Alcohol Rehab Centers - Lawson, MO.

Inpatient drug rehab, also sometimes called residential drug rehab, is a treatment method for people that need a change of environment and a more aggressive intervention while in treatment. Inpatient treatment in Lawson typically lasts anywhere from 1 month to 3 - 6 months or longer, and many facilities provide both short and long term rehabilitation options. Additionally, some inpatient facilities are prepared to provide both drug free and medication assisted detoxification services, but some only treat people who have already been detoxed at a detoxification program prior to arrival.

In inpatient residential drug rehab, it is much like a small community of clients and staff all functioning collectively through the course of rehabilitation. Rehab staff will do a complete evaluation of the individual's treatment needs, and a treatment plan is put in place that may involve counseling, therapy, holistic treatment, psychotherapy, etc. based on what recovery approach that program is using. Many inpatient programs concentrate on the 12 steps, whereas others employ a therapeutic behavioral approach, which could incorporate the latest developments in addiction therapies.

Inpatient drug rehab also reduces many of the risks associated with relapse, because the client is continually supervised in a drug and alcohol free environment, and won't have access to any of the drug using friends who motivated, supported or empowered their drug abuse.
